Why Concrete Driveways Are the Smart Choice for Madisonville TX Homes
When we first started working with homeowners in Madisonville TX, one thing became clear: concrete driveways are a practical and attractive investment. Unlike asphalt or gravel, concrete offers durability and a clean, polished look that enhances curb appeal instantly. Our experience shows that a well-installed concrete driveway can last 30 years or more with minimal maintenance, making it a cost-effective choice for many families.
We see many clients appreciate how concrete driveways stand up to Texas weather, from the intense summer heat to occasional rainfall. Concrete doesn’t soften or rut like asphalt can, and it doesn’t wash away like gravel. This resilience saves our neighbors both time and money in repairs. Plus, modern concrete mixes and finishes allow us to customize each driveway to fit the home’s style—whether that’s a smooth finish, stamped patterns mimicking stone or tile, or exposed aggregates for texture.
Concrete driveways also improve safety. The surface is less slippery when wet compared to other materials, reducing accident risks when entering or exiting vehicles. Installation by experienced contractors like us ensures proper drainage and grading, preventing puddles and ice patches during colder months. Choosing the Right Concrete Mix and Finish
Selecting the correct concrete mix is essential. Higher strength mixes resist cracking, while additives can improve curing in hot weather. We use locally-sourced materials formulated specifically for Texas climates. This ensures your driveway maintains strength and surface integrity.
Finish options are also vital for appearance and slip resistance. Popular choices include:
– Broom Finish: Creates fine grooves, enhancing traction.
– Stamped or Stained Concrete: Offers decorative options resembling stone or brick.
– Exposed Aggregate: Reveals natural stones, adding texture and grip.
We help clients visualize finishes and select what suits their home style best. Our goal is to blend beauty with performance, making the concrete driveway a proud feature in Madisonville TX neighborhoods.
The Installation Process: What to Expect from Expert Concrete Driveway Contractors
We’ve installed hundreds of concrete driveways across Madisonville TX, and while each project is unique, the process generally follows four key stages that homeowners should anticipate.
1. Excavation and Base Preparation
First, we clear the existing surface, removing grass, topsoil, or old driveway materials. Proper excavation sets the stage for long-term durability. We then compact and level the soil to create a stable base, which prevents future settling. A gravel sub-base may be laid to improve drainage beneath the concrete.
2. Formwork and Reinforcement
Next, we install wooden or metal forms that outline the driveway edges, defining its shape precisely. Steel reinforcement bars (rebar) or wire mesh are placed within the forms to strengthen the concrete and resist cracking under heavy loads.
3. Pouring and Finishing the Concrete
We pour the concrete carefully to avoid air pockets or uneven thickness. Using specialized tools, the surface is leveled and smoothed or textured according to the planned finish. Timing is crucial here; we supervise the curing process closely to prevent premature drying or cracking, especially during hot, dry days common in Madisonville TX.
4. Curing and Final Touches
Concrete must cure properly for optimal strength. We advise homeowners to limit foot and vehicle traffic for several days. During this period, we may apply sealers to resist stains and improve longevity. Clean-up is thorough, leaving the site neat and ready for use.

Maintaining Your Concrete Driveway for Lasting Beauty and Strength
Owning a concrete driveway in Madisonville TX is a rewarding experience, and with regular maintenance, it can look great for decades. From our years working in the region, we recommend a straightforward care routine that everyone can follow.
– Regular Cleaning: Washing the driveway with a garden hose or pressure washer removes dirt, debris, and stains. This preserves the surface and prevents buildup that could cause discoloration.
– Sealant Application: We suggest resealing concrete every 2-3 years to protect against water penetration, chemical spills, and freeze-thaw damage. Our clients appreciate how sealants maintain a fresh look and simplify cleaning.
– Prompt Repairs: Cracks or chips should be addressed quickly. We offer repair services that fill minor defects before they expand, saving money and preventing structural issues.
– Avoiding Harsh Chemicals: In Madisonville TX, many homes use fertilizers or de-icing salts in winter. We caution against these on concrete because they can degrade the surface over time.
– Drainage Checks: Make sure water flows away from the driveway to avoid pooling that can weaken the base. Proper grading installed initially helps, but we recommend periodic inspections, especially after storms.
Implementing these simple steps leads to a strong, attractive concrete driveway that enhances property value and enjoyment.
